FWIW......here's something that might help some other people stop the late loading and the page 'jumping' around. I use the Mozilla browser and the following works for me (and, it's plain, non-tech-nerd language:))

For any new page I open (like coming onto the site or entering a particular forum) as soon as the page appears, I click the X in the top left corner of the screen (where either the refresh symbol or a 'X' appears), the loading stops and I just continue on.

When I click on the 'get updates' button of a thread, then as soon as the page appears on the screen and the "waiting for..." shows up at the bottom corner, , I highlight the url bar and press enter. The page immediately stabilizes on the screen at the point where the new posts start. I then click the X in the top left corner of the screen (where either the refresh symbol or a 'X' appears)......the phoney loading stops and I'm good to go.

It's a couple of extra steps, but it saves me some stress.
